Excitatory Signal
A type of neurotransmitter-induced signal in the nervous system that increases the likelihood of a neuron firing an action potential.
Action Potential
A sudden increase and subsequent decrease in the voltage across a cell membrane resulting from the movement of charged particles.
Neural Communication
The process by which neurons transmit signals to each other through synapses, using both electrical and chemical means.
